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/django/24.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 如何修复django.contrib.auth.models.AnonymousUser-to-User_Python_Django_Django Users - Fatal编程技术网

Python 如何修复django.contrib.auth.models.AnonymousUser-to-User

Python 如何修复django.contrib.auth.models.AnonymousUser-to-User,python,django,django-users,Python,Django,Django Users,大家好,我正在制作电子商务web项目,我尝试将用户与购物车关联,但我对is_authenticated()方法有问题,当用户登录时,它是工作的,但它是注销的,显示此错误“ValueError:无法分配”“:“cart.user”必须是“user”实例“” 我希望能工作。试试看 if request.user.is_authenticated: 代替 request.user.is_authenticated() 这会产生错误:“bool对象不可调用” request.user.is_aut

大家好,我正在制作电子商务web项目,我尝试将用户与购物车关联,但我对
is_authenticated()
方法有问题,当用户登录时,它是工作的,但它是注销的,显示此错误
“ValueError:无法分配”“:“cart.user”必须是“user”实例“”

我希望能工作。

试试看

if request.user.is_authenticated: 
代替

request.user.is_authenticated()
这会产生错误:“bool对象不可调用”
request.user.is_authenticated()